00020 #include <libexplain/ac/errno.h>
00021 #include <libexplain/ac/linux/videodev2.h>
00022 #include <libexplain/ac/sys/ioctl.h>
00023 
00024 #include <libexplain/buffer/int.h>
00025 #include <libexplain/buffer/is_the_null_pointer.h>
00026 #include <libexplain/iocontrol/generic.h>
00027 #include <libexplain/iocontrol/vidioc_overlay.h>
00028 
00029 #ifdef VIDIOC_OVERLAY
00030 
00031 
00032 static void
00033 print_data(const explain_iocontrol_t *p, explain_string_buffer_t *sb,
00034     int errnum, int fildes, int request, const void *data)
00035 {
00036     (void)p;
00037     (void)errnum;
00038     (void)fildes;
00039     (void)request;
00040     explain_buffer_int_star(sb, data);
00041 }
00042 
00043 
00044 static void
00045 print_explanation(const explain_iocontrol_t *p, explain_string_buffer_t *sb,
00046     int errnum, int fildes, int request, const void *data)
00047 {
00048     switch (errnum)
00049     {
00050     case EINVAL:
00051         if (!data)
00052         {
00053             explain_buffer_is_the_null_pointer(sb, "data");
00054             return;
00055         }
00056 
00057         {
00058             struct v4l2_capability cap;
00059 
00060             if (ioctl(fildes, VIDIOC_QUERYCAP, &cap) < 0)
00061                 goto generic;
00062             if (!(cap.capabilities & V4L2_CAP_VIDEO_OVERLAY))
00063             {
00064                 explain_string_buffer_puts
00065                 (
00066                     sb,
00067                     /* FIXME: i18n */
00068                     "the device does not support overlay"
00069                 );
00070                 return;
00071             }
00072         }
00073 
00074         /* No idea */
00075         goto generic;
00076 
00077     default:
00078         generic:
00079         explain_iocontrol_generic_print_explanation
00080         (
00081             p,
00082             sb,
00083             errnum,
00084             fildes,
00085             request,
00086             data
00087         );
00088         break;
00089     }
00090 }
00091 
00092 
00093 const explain_iocontrol_t explain_iocontrol_vidioc_overlay =
00094 {
00095     "VIDIOC_OVERLAY", /* name */
00096     VIDIOC_OVERLAY, /* value */
00097     0, /* disambiguate */
00098     0, /* print_name */
00099     print_data,
00100     print_explanation,
00101     0, /* print_data_returned */
00102     sizeof(int), /* data_size */
00103     "int *", /* data_type */
00104     0, /* flags */
00105     __FILE__,
00106     __LINE__,
00107 };
00108 
00109 #else /* ndef VIDIOC_OVERLAY */
00110 
00111 const explain_iocontrol_t explain_iocontrol_vidioc_overlay =
00112 {
00113     0, /* name */
00114     0, /* value */
00115     0, /* disambiguate */
00116     0, /* print_name */
00117     0, /* print_data */
00118     0, /* print_explanation */
00119     0, /* print_data_returned */
00120     0, /* data_size */
00121     0, /* data_type */
00122     0, /* flags */
00123     __FILE__,
00124     __LINE__,
00125 };
00126 
00127 #endif /* VIDIOC_OVERLAY */
